The CAN terminating resistor is used to terminate the can bus that the Talon SRX, Victor SRX, and other FRC components use to communicate.

    To wire a CAN bus, connect a yellow signal wire to the CAN terminal marked "H" on the NI roboRIO and connect a green signal wire to the CAN terminal marked "L" on the NI roboRIO. To connect additional Talon SRXs connect additional green to green wires and yellow to yellow wires. After all of the Talon SRXs have been wired, there will be two remaining signal wires. These two wires must be connected to this resister to terminate the CAN bus if not using the Power Distribution Panel to do so.
